FIG. 61. — Bothriolepis jani Lukševičs, 1986; A, PVL LDM 100/434; B, proximal segment of the pectoral appendage LDM 100/435; C, CD1 LDM 100/130; D, CD1 LDM 100/133; E, CV1 LDM 100/134; F, ML2 LDM 100/378. Skujaine River near Klūnas village, Latvia. Tērvete Formation. Abbreviations: CD1, 2, central dorsal plates 1 and 2; CV1, ventral central plate 1; ML2, lateral marginal plate 2; MM2, mesial marginal plate 2; dc, dorsal corner of lateral lamina; oa.AVL, area overlapped by AVL; PVL, posterior ventro lateral plate; vlr, ventro-lateral ridge. Scale bar: 5 mm.
